Asian Paints Unveils ‘Cherish’ as the Colour of the Year for 2021

The Colour of the Year, Cherish, appreciates the fleeting joys of life and gives us reasons to smile.

Mumbai: As 2021 brings with it a tingling energy and an intention to start afresh, Asian Paints brings forth the 18th edition of ColourNext, the most comprehensive forecast of colours and design trends in India, announcing the most anticipated, Colour of the Year – Cherish.

The Colour of the Year, Cherish, appreciates the fleeting joys of life and gives us reasons to smile. Cherish (Colour code – Ivy League 7585), is a nurturing, humble and fresh colour that restores a sense of balance, neither too warm nor cold. Its mint green shade nudges growth while a hint of blue revitalises one’s mood.


It brings restless minds to a place of hope so one can imagine a better world and a more balanced self. This restorative yet effervescent shade is set to be a trend-setter for 2021 inspiring all aspects of design, be it paints, interiors, textiles, architecture or product design. It induces a feeling of hope that’s both enduring and uplifting.

After studying colour and its myriad influences on lifestyle in India, Asian Paints ColourNext, also unveils the four colour trends of 2021 – Habitat, A Home New World, Felicity, Z Futures. These trends have a far-reaching influence and are the only India-specific colour and decor trends forecast since 2003. With ColourNext, Asian Paints aims to inspire a multitude of design disciplines in 2021.

Speaking on ColourNext, Amit Syngle, MD & CEO, Asian Paints Limited, said, “The ColourNext trends and Colour of the Year are awaited with much excitement and anticipation every year.

Various experts from the field of interior design, architecture, product design, textile and fashion, as well as marketing and technology, scout the country and the globe looking for inspiration and influences that can resonate with an Indian audience at large.

While the four new trends, have specially been curated keeping in mind the new life and the distinct outlook towards everything post lockdown, Cherish as a colour is sure to create a wave in the vast and influential world of design and brand marketing.”
